Barker Ross are Recruiting - Utilities Team Leader (Water Mains)

Location: Nottingham
Start Date: January 2026
Pay: 22 - 23 per hour (depending on experience & tickets)

6 months work

Barker Ross are looking for an experienced Utilities / Civils Team Leader to oversee teams carrying out water mains installation works. This role requires a highly trained leader with strong utilities knowledge and the ability to manage safe dig operations on complex projects.

Required Qualifications & Tickets:

  • EUSR Safe Dig (Cat 1 & 2)
  • Blue Card
  • SHEA
  • NRSWA Streetworks
  • Confined Space
  • Digger & Dumper
  • Moling
  • Pipe Trailer Awareness
  • Electro-fusion (E/F) Blue Box Training
  • City & Guilds Butt Fusion

Role Overview:

  • Leading utilities teams installing and connecting new water mains
  • Supervising deep excavations and safe dig operations
  • Overseeing moling, pipe installation and reinstatement work
  • Ensuring full compliance with RAMS and SHE procedures
  • Completing toolbox talks & site briefings
  • Liaising with engineers, site managers and client teams
